Summary
The Mechanics of Materials Lab at LUT University, Finland, is seeking a highly motivated Postdoctoral Researcher to join its research team working on hydrogen–material interactions and the development of safe metallic energy infrastructure. The successful candidate will gain access to state-of-the-art facilities for studying gaseous hydrogen interactions with metallic materials, advanced post-processing techniques, and hydrogen characterization methods. This position offers an exciting opportunity to contribute to cutting-edge research supporting the future of clean energy and hydrogen technologies.

Job Description
The selected Postdoctoral Researcher will:
- Conduct advanced research on the interaction of gaseous hydrogen with metallic materials.
- Investigate material performance and degradation mechanisms relevant to hydrogen infrastructure.
- Utilize state-of-the-art hydrogen characterization and post-processing facilities.
- Study and develop materials for hydrogen transport and storage applications, including pipeline steels, advanced steels, and lightweight metals.
- Contribute to the design of safe and reliable metallic energy infrastructure.
- Publish research findings in high-impact scientific journals and present results at international conferences.
- Collaborate with multidisciplinary researchers working in clean energy and hydrogen technologies.
